About

F. Norwood is a scholar working on Neurology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. According to data from OpenAlex, F. Norwood has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 279 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Neurology, 2 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 2 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in F. Norwood’s work include Myasthenia Gravis and Thymoma (2 papers), Genetic Neurodegenerative Diseases (2 papers) and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(1 paper). F. Norwood is often cited by papers focused on Myasthenia Gravis and Thymoma (2 papers), Genetic Neurodegenerative Diseases (2 papers) and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(1 paper). F. Norwood coll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and The Netherlands. F. Norwood's co-authors include Heinz Jungbluth, S. Robb, David Hilton‐Jones, Peter J. Maddison and Ian Galea and has published in prestigious journals such as Neurology, Journal of Neurology Neurosurgery & Psychiatry and Clinical Neurophysiology.
